This review is from: The Inductor Handbook: A Comprehensive Guide For Correct Component Selection In All Circuit Applications. Know What To Use When And Where. (Paperback)
The Inductor Handbook was a real disappointment. The information is a superficial overview of how to select inductors for basic applications. It might be suitable for a hobbyist or student but is not the caliber of information required by a modern technical professional. There is little information about the design of inductors and no information about computer modeling - crucial in today's environment. More useful information can be obtained from manufacturer's spec sheets and application notes.
